Engineered wood flooring has surged in popularity in recent years. While it may initially resemble laminate flooring, it boasts significant differences. Engineered wood features a top layer of real solid wood, typically between 3-6mm thick, extending the floor's lifespan. Unlike laminate, engineered wood can be sanded 2-4 times, allowing you to refurbish your floors instead of replacing them when they appear tired and worn.
Strength and Stability
The solid wood veneer sits atop a base usually made of multi-layer ply, 3 core ply, or HDF. This composition gives engineered wood flooring excellent strength and stability. It is more resistant to changes in humidity and temperature than solid wood, making it a practical choice for various environments.
